BP> inccorect a ipv4 dns server can still resolve ipv6 hostnames to ipv6 BP> ips Possibly, but what will the IPv4 only node do with that data? An IPv4 only node will be looking for A records only (it doesn't know what an AAAA record is), and if there isn't a A record in DNS, it will fail to resolve the name to an IP address.
